The Choice to Live Without Solving the Question


Are you prepared to live fully while still holding onto the question?

Introduction

As we live, we occasionally encounter questions that have no answer.

These are not things that appear only once in a lifetime; they may stand in our way repeatedly, changing their form each time.


In this piece, I would like to pause and think about a way of being that involves living with these questions, rather than trying to 'solve' them.

1. A question is not something that disappears once solved

A question is not like homework that ends once you write down the correct answer.

In fact, the more you try to provide an answer, the more it may return in a different form.


  • A feeling of being unfulfilled remains no matter what you do

  • The feeling that 'this should be enough' never goes away

  • Being excessively swayed by the words and evaluations of others

I feel that deep within such discomfort, there often lurks a question that has not yet been put into words.

Rather than being a nuisance, a question might bean existence that changes its form and appears if you keep ignoring it.



2. The more you rush for an answer, the further the question drifts away

When we encounter a question, we tend to think, 'I must find an answer quickly.'

This is because standing still without knowing the reason makes us anxious.

  • Feeling like I cannot move forward unless I verbalize the meaning

  • Feeling uneasy about being in a state that cannot be explained to those around me

  • Somewhere, I deny the part of myself that is lost


However, the more a question is rushed, the more it tends to fall silent.
The moment you apply words to it, you may end up with an answer that feels somehow fake.

What the question truly wants to touch might bethe texture before 'correctness'rather than 'correctness' itself.



3. The choice to live while holding onto the question

Continuing to hold onto a question without solving it is not an easy path.
This is because you have to go about your days while your uncertainty remains.

  • Even if you choose something, you never reach complete satisfaction

  • There are moments when your own core seems ambiguous

  • You might be seen by those around you as someone hard to understand

Even so, there is a unique stillness in a way of life that does not let go of the question.

Because the question exists, you can avoid making light, definitive statements.
You can avoid completely discarding the self that stands still in not knowing.

There are moments when that uncertainty itself feels somehow sincere.



4. Resolve is not strength, but an attitude of acceptance

The word 'resolve' gives the impression of bracing oneself strongly.

However, the resolve to live with a question might be something much quieter.

  • Living through today even while not knowing

  • Not overly denying the decisions made while wavering, even after the fact

  • Forgiving yourself somewhere for the fact that the question does not disappear


The resolve to carry a question feels closer toan attitude of accepting the self that includes hesitation, rather than the power to erase itI feel.

There is no need to be impressive, nor any need to show it to anyone.
It is simply an attitude of not leaving behind the self that holds the question.



5. The Weight of the Phrase 'Living Fully'

The phrase 'living fully' might sound somewhat extreme.

I don't think it means doing everything or reaching a satisfying conclusion.


  • The possibility that life ends with questions still remaining

  • The fact that there are things we will never understand until the end

  • Even so, the sense that there was time spent with those questions


Living fully while holding onto questions might mean continuing to walk without abandoning an unfinished story midway.

Even if no answer is found, the time spent living while carrying the question speaks for itself.
Whether or not one can believe that seems to be a quiet turning point.

If you have an enduring question deep in your heart right now,

perhaps you don't need to rush to resolve it.

I believe that living today with the question itself is already a choice.
